#1dba9e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1dba9e is composed of 11.4% red, 72.9% green and 62%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 15.1% yellow and 27.1% black. It has a hue angle of 169.3 degrees, a saturation of 73% and a lightness of 42.2%. #1dba9e color hex could be obtained by blending #3affff with #00753d. Closest websafe color is: #33cc99.

Shades and Tints of #1dba9e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#03100e is the darkest color, while #feffff is the lightest one.
